Given our New England climate and road conditions, common issues include suspension wear from potholes, brake corrosion from winter road salt, and problems with 4WD/AWD systems on models like the Sierra and Terrain. Electrical issues related to infotainment systems are also frequent in newer models.

Repair costs can be slightly higher due to the specialized technology in GMC trucks and SUVs, but they are competitive locally. Getting quotes from a few Marlborough shops for non-warranty work is wise, as independent specialists often offer better value than dealerships for older models.
The seasonal extremes require diligent attention to coolant/antifreeze levels and battery health before winter. More frequent undercarriage washes to combat road salt corrosion and more frequent air filter changes due to pollen and dust are also key local considerations for maintaining your GMC.
